Conor Diffin
Conor is a doctor splitting his time between general practice, emergency medicine, remote medicine, and the great outdoors, pursuing expeditions in the Himalayas, Mongolia, and the High Atlas.

Dr Sophie Redlin
Sophie Redlin is a GP, Expedition Doctor, Researcher in Medical Anthropology and Documentary Filmmaker.

Erin Linwood
Erin is a resident doctor and expedition leader. She regularly leads groups in the hills and mountains of the UK and has led youth expeditions overseas in Africa, North America and Central Asia.

Jake Hankinson
Jake is a junior doctor working and living in Cornwall, with a particular interest in Expedition Medicine.

Kathryn Green
Kat is a junior doctor based in Glasgow, currently working in emergency medicine. She is interested in global health due to the impacts of climate change on communities around the world, and the adventure of expedition medicine.

Lucy Penny
Lucy is a child and adult student nurse passionate about expedition medicine and connecting young people to nature for both personal and environmental health.
